64.

Consideration of applications for dispensation

To consider any application for dispensation made by a Councillor in respect of the Council’s forthcoming consideration of the Budget for 2017-18 on 23 February 2017.

 

The relevant extract from the terms of reference for the Audit and Governance Committee is as follows:

 

“To grant dispensations to Councillors and co-opted Members related to interests specified in the Code of Conduct for Members following written requests to the proper officer (Chief Executive) by a Member or Co-opted Member under section 33 of the Localism Act 2011, when the Council:

 

·       Considers that granting the dispensation is in the interests of persons living in the authority’s area

 

·       Considers that it is otherwise appropriate to grant a dispensation; and

 

·       Considers appeals against decisions made by the Monitoring Officer in exercise of their dispensation powers.”

 

Minutes:

The Committee considered the application for dispensation submitted by Councillor Kevin Stephens, in respect of his disclosed pecuniary interest in the grant paid by Gloucester City Council to Gloucester Law Centre where his spouse was currently employed as a Solicitor.

 

RESOLVED

 

(1)  That a dispensation be granted to Councillor Kevin Stevens from Section 31 (4) of the Localism Act 2011, because it is in the interests of persons living in the Council’s area (s33 (2) c) and otherwise appropriate (33 (2) e), to allow the Councillor to participate in the business of the Council in relation to the determination of the Budget, except in circumstances where, by way of a motion or amendment, the matter under consideration refers specifically and predominantly to the Councillor’s disclosable pecuniary or other interest(s). 

 

(2)  That the dispensation shall have effect from 22 February 2017 to 30 April 2020.
